Subject: Scheduled key rotation for Pulseguard health checks

Team,

As part of our quarterly rotation, the credential used by the Lanternwall load balancer to call the Pulseguard health-check endpoint has been replaced. Future maintainers should note that the old key stops working at the end of the month, and every probe configuration must be updated before then to avoid false-negative health states. The replacement key follows below for your records.

app token of badug-tahaf = qvz11-nP5FBNr8qnh

MEMO — Kettling Depot Receiving

Uniform sets for the new Kettling depot arrive Wednesday via Ashgrove courier: 40 boxes, sorted by size, manifest attached to box one. Check the count at the dock before signing; shortages go straight to stores, not the courier. The hand-over instruction the courier will follow is set out below.

drop instructions, tafof-baguf: the holmir gilox courier leaves the sormir ulaok holdor ledger at gate 5596 under passcode 257343

## Local Setup — Pickpath Optimizer

Hey on-call — if Pickpath is acting up, easiest fix path is running it locally. Clone the repo, install deps with the setup script, and seed a sample warehouse layout using the fixtures task. The optimizer recalculates pick routes every time the bin inventory table changes, so most incidents trace back to stale bin data. Logs go to stdout in dev mode, nice and chatty. Point your local instance at the shared staging database using the connection string below.

replica DSN, kajep-yahag: mssql://praok_svc:iF@db-8d68.plorvaio.local:5432/eliion

Memo — courier change, effective immediately. Thorngate Express missed yesterday's 16:00 pickup with no notice; the contract is suspended. All outbound freight from the Aldermoor warehouse now goes through Kestrel Haulage. Same dock, same cut-off times. Update the booking sheet and inform the evening crew before tonight's run. Paperwork format is unchanged except the carrier field. Pass the instruction below to the Kestrel driver at hand-over.

dispatch memo: the eliok quenok courier leaves the sorael aldath belion tammir casix gileth queniel jorath ledger at gate 9299 under passcode 897989